When it comes to deploying Elastic on Azure Elasticsearch service on Azure, is our SAS offering that helps user focus on getting value from their data while we at Elastic host their Elastic deployments. However, we do realize, as I mentioned earlier, that a lot of the times you have your architectural reasons where you would want to manage it yourself.

And Microsoft and Elastic realize that and we want to ensure that we back you irrespective of what your deployment option is. So that's where if you're going down the route of self manage, we are going to be part of that journey as well. There is Azure templates available on the marketplace that let you deploy on Azure instances. We also have an operator for Kubernetes ecosystems.

If you want to deploy Elasticsearch and manage it over Azure Kubernetes services, you can do so with confidence that there is there is a solution there from Elastic to back you. As I mentioned earlier, both the variations whether you pick up the SaaS from Elastic or you want to manage it yourself, both those options are available today on Azure Marketplace to get you going quickly. The second tenet of the partnership focuses on enabling the users to be able to get Azure ecosystem data sources quickly, leveraging the turnkey integrations that are provided, whether it's logs, metrics, or security events that you're looking to capture from Azure Ecosystem, Elastic provides out of the box integrations for those and visualizations to get value from that data. So Workplace Search is an easy to use search solution with built-in connectivity to your organization's data sources and provides secure access to information aligned with your existing document security. It's built on top of Elasticsearch and Elastic Stack, and it includes off the shelf and user and admin interfaces so you can deliver a powerful and customizable search experience to your organization right away. You can also leverage the API's to embed search as a service into other applications that you might have in your organization. Workplace Search also facilitates fast data ingestion with dedicated content sources so that data from your content sources are indexed instantly and become usable. There are, there is an ever evolving content source portfolio that supports common data sources like OneDrive, GitHub, SharePoint Online. For any legacy data that you have or one-time ingest, there's also a custom API source to permit data ingest using HTTP requests or using dedicated APIs.

and your favorite library, Python, no.js, Ruby. Workplace search allows you to search across your whole organization with a single query, so you don't need to know which source to look in. Workplace search brings you the relevant search results from all your sources. The technology ensures that you get a fair search, so it has a summary panel on the left side showing how many hits there were for each content source, and it also gives you a preview of the content on the right side so that you know what information you're going to retrieve.

It also gives you search experiences that are familiar to users like facet searching, filtering, type ahead, and once you start typing in the search bar. Workplace Search also enables access control through group and role based access, so you can choose between managing the users directly in workplace search; you can manage them at the Elastic layer, or you can use a third party authentication provider like author or Okta and manage Access control via SAML. So one final note on personalization. Workplace search also has the concept of private sources, which is really great.

As the. As the name indicates, private sources allow non admin users to connect sources that matters them. So for in this case.

A user myself may use drop box for storing information that's specific to my role, but that might not apply to teammates, so private searches are only searchable for the user that connects to them and it really gives workplace search a degree of customization that makes it even easier and even more efficient for customers and users and organizations to find the information that they're looking for.
